Output 254676954606bfba16bcb551ee65da2cf533aeb746b714eea9f0c3fbdf02af6e:0

value
23893909
script pubkey
OP_0 OP_PUSHBYTES_20 ef51866f5a7367656666290d11d6c050d6f5866a
address
bc1qaagcvm66wdnk2enx9yx3r4kq2rt0tpn2zdu8ph
transaction
254676954606bfba16bcb551ee65da2cf533aeb746b714eea9f0c3fbdf02af6e